North and South American Indexes

The North and South American indexes show the value of stocks. Big ones include the New York Stock Exchange (NYSE) and Nasdaq in North America. They have many types of stocks from companies all over the world.

In South America, we have Bovespa in Brazil and Merval in Argentina. These indexes help us see how well businesses are doing there. Stocks go up if a business is doing well, but they drop when it’s not so good.

Watching these numbers helps investors make choices about where to put their money.

World Currencies

World currencies play a crucial role in global markets. They are the different types of money used by countries around the world, such as the US dollar, Euro, British pound, Japanese yen, and many others.

These currencies can fluctuate in value against each other due to factors like economic conditions, interest rates, political stability, and market demand. Investors and traders pay close attention to currency exchange rates because they can impact international trade and investment opportunities.

Understanding how world currencies behave is essential for navigating global markets effectively and making informed financial decisions.

Emerging markets

Emerging markets are countries with developing economies that show potential for growth and investment opportunities. These markets often have lower income levels, growing populations, and improving infrastructure.

Examples of emerging markets include Brazil, India, China, and South Africa. Investing in emerging markets can be attractive because they offer the potential for higher returns compared to more established economies.

However, it is important to note that investing in these markets also carries greater risks due to factors such as political instability and currency fluctuations. Despite the risks, many investors are drawn to emerging markets because they present opportunities for diversification and long-term growth.

Impact of global events on markets

Global events have a big impact on markets around the world. For example, changes in trade policies or political instability can cause stock markets to go up or down. The COVID-19 pandemic is a recent example of a global event that had a major effect on markets.

Many countries went into lockdown, which disrupted businesses and caused stock prices to drop. On the other hand, news of vaccine development and government stimulus measures boosted market sentiment and led to recovery in some sectors.

It’s important for investors to keep an eye on these global events because they can have significant implications for their investments.

Indices overview

Global stock indices are an important tool for understanding the performance of global markets. They provide a snapshot of how different countries’ stock markets are performing at any given time.

The world’s major stock exchanges, such as the New York Stock Exchange (NYSE), Tokyo Stock Exchange, and London Stock Exchange, each have their own index that tracks the overall performance of stocks listed on their exchange.

Additionally, there are broader indices like the MSCI World Index and the S&P Global Broad Market Index that cover multiple markets worldwide. These indices help investors gauge market trends and make informed decisions based on market movements.

For example, if a particular index is showing consistent growth over time, it may indicate a bullish market trend in that country or region. On the other hand, if an index is experiencing declines, it could suggest economic challenges or investor caution in that market.

Market performance analysis

Global market performance analysis involves examining the trends and movements of various stock indices around the world. It provides insights into how different markets are performing and helps investors make informed decisions.

For example, the global fixed income market has seen a 3.3% increase year over year, reaching $126.9 trillion in outstanding value. Additionally, the global long-term debt market stands at $63.4 trillion.

It is essential to keep track of these figures as they indicate overall market health and investor sentiment. Furthermore, monitoring international trade statistics can also provide valuable information about global economic trends that impact market performance.

Diversification

Diversification is an important strategy when investing in global markets. It means spreading your investments across different asset classes (like stocks, bonds, and commodities) and regions to reduce risk.

By diversifying, you can protect yourself from the potential losses of any single investment. For example, if one country’s economy performs poorly, having investments in other countries can help balance out any negative impact.

Diversification also allows you to take advantage of different opportunities in various markets. So instead of putting all your eggs in one basket, it’s wise to diversify and spread your investments globally.
